Why Energy Waste Persists
Three structural flaws drive this inefficiency cycle:
- Legacy HVAC systems designed for 24/7 operation in intermittently used spaces
- Mixed-mode lighting installations lacking occupancy sensors
- Data silos between IoT devices and energy management platforms
Decoding the Energy Efficiency Paradox
Modern energy performance contracts (EPCs) demonstrate how companies can achieve 30-40% energy savings in meeting spaces through phased upgrades. Take Singapore's BCA Green Mark certification system – their tiered approach helped 72% of participating firms reduce meeting room energy use by an average of 28% within 18 months.
Solution | ROI Timeline | Carbon Impact |
---|---|---|
Smart HVAC zoning | 2.3 years | 12.7 tCO2e/year |
Dynamic glass windows | 4.1 years | 8.9 tCO2e/year |
AI-powered load forecasting | 1.8 years | 15.4 tCO2e/year |

The Human Factor in Tech Adoption
During a recent client workshop, we discovered employees override energy-saving meeting room settings 43% of the time due to thermal discomfort. The fix? Adaptive comfort algorithms that learn individual preferences while maintaining efficiency thresholds. It's not about tech vs. people – it's about designing systems that respect both.
